Click for full colour range |  White Rose Mohair by Texere YarnsThis is a glorious, smooth and lustrous 98% mohair yarn (with just 2% nylon that's added when spinning) that has never left Yorkshire! The angora goats live on a farm less than 50 miles from Texere Yarns and live a happy life roaming around the farm getting shorn twice a year when their hair gets to about 150mm in length. (This is as free range and organic as it gets!) There are no air miles here, just a little journey round West Yorkshire as the fibre is scoured and carded in Halifax, spun in Bradford, dyed in Huddersfield, balled in Wakefield, then it's sold from our mill back here in Bradford! The yarn has a lovely handle - it's soft, strong, warm and nowhere near as hairy as traditional brushed mohair.
